Very nice and interesting WW2 KIA Purple Heart document. The document is named to Staff Sergeant John L. Crocker (service number: 35329318), member of H Company, 314th Infantry Regiment of the 79th Infantry Division. Crocker was KIA on the 30th of November 1944 during the fighting in and around Haguenau, France. Crocker is buried at Plot B, Row 3, Grave 25, Epinal American Cemetery, Epinal, France. The Purple Heart award certificate was awarded on the 27th of January 1945. The award certificate remains in a very good condition as can be seen on the photos. No repairs, no damage.
